Exploring Edinburg's Crime Map: Your Guide to Safety and Awareness

Edinburg, Texas, is a vibrant city known for its rich cultural diversity, friendly communities, and growing economy. While the city offers many opportunities and attractions, staying informed about local safety is essential. Our comprehensive crime map of Edinburg provides residents and visitors with valuable insights into crime patterns, helping you navigate the city confidently and securely.

Key Features of the Crime Map

Edinburgโ€™s crime map offers several helpful tools:

  • Crime Categorization: Incidents are sorted into types such as theft, assault, and vandalism, each represented with distinct icons or colors.
  • Time Filters: Analyze data from specific periods to observe patterns and trends.
  • Heat Maps: Visualize areas with higher concentrations of criminal activity.
  • Incident Details: Click on locations to view detailed information about each crime, including date and type.

Crime Trends in Edinburg

Understanding current crime trends helps residents stay vigilant. Recent data indicates:

  • Property Crimes: Burglary, theft, and vehicle thefts are prevalent in certain neighborhoods.
  • Violent Crimes: Incidents such as assault and robbery are less frequent but still occur, especially in high-traffic areas.
  • Drug-Related Offenses: Drug activity impacts some regions, emphasizing the need for community cooperation.
